Tab Energy

TaB Energy is marketed as a low calorie energy drink named after TaB, Coca Cola's original low-calorie cola brand. While it shares the TaB name, it is not a cola product like the original TaB. Fashion Week Daily describes it as a “sweet and sour beverage” with a taste “reminiscent of a liquid Jolly Rancher”. Some drinkers alternatively label the taste as reminding them of strawberry or watermelon Nerds, and find it bitter yet quenching. Others still find that it has a distinct leafy taste. It is sweetened with sucralose (rather than saccharin), is pale pink, and lightly carbonated.

It is packed in 10.5-US-fluid-ounce (311 ml) slim cans (with a shape similar to the can used for Red Bull). The New Yorker notes than the original Tab has 31 milligrams of caffeine and less than 1 calorie (4.2 kJ) per serving, while TaB Energy has 95 milligrams of caffeine and 5 calories (21 kJ). (It also contains 785 mg taurine, 116 mg ginseng extract, 19 mg carnitine, and 0.90 mg guarana extract, according to the can.)

The drink is currently being targeted and advertised towards a female market as illustrated by the pink color theme and slogan 'Fuel to be Fabulous'. The song used in the American version of the commercial is "Cobrastyle" by the Teddybears.

TaB Energy is also available in Mexico since December 2006, in New Zealand since February 26, 2007, and in Spain since September 2008 under the name TaB Fabulous. This drink is currently being taken off the market by Coca-Cola.
